diff options
author | danielkvist <d94.zaragoza@gmail.com> | 2019-03-25 13:40:26 +0300 |
---|---|---|
committer | danielkvist <d94.zaragoza@gmail.com> | 2019-03-25 13:40:26 +0300 |
commit | 21902d77677b05b7fdb2126550ef0c03c961362e (patch) | |
tree | a86e67f7cb0bee648012e11be9337bed42a4a317 /assets | |
parent | 33e452a8fa700877e59f200cedcb499bf317cb4a (diff) |
add styles for contact form and fix Font Awesome
Diffstat (limited to 'assets')
-rw-r--r-- | assets/css/base.css | 21 | ||||
-rw-r--r-- | assets/css/style.css | 49 |
2 files changed, 61 insertions, 9 deletions
diff --git a/assets/css/base.css b/assets/css/base.css index dfd934d..99473be 100644 --- a/assets/css/base.css +++ b/assets/css/base.css @@ -8,7 +8,7 @@ a:hover { body { background-color: var(--background); - color: var(--base); + color: var(--text); font-size: var(--base); } @@ -43,14 +43,21 @@ header { z-index: 999; } -textarea { - resize: none; -} - -p { - color: var(--text); +label { + display: none; } main { min-height: 100vh; +} + +input { + color: var(--background); + font-size: var(--p); + margin-top: 1.25rem; + padding: 0.5rem 0.45rem; +} + +input:required { + outline-color: var(--red); }
\ No newline at end of file diff --git a/assets/css/style.css b/assets/css/style.css index 63a32ff..4825b3c 100644 --- a/assets/css/style.css +++ b/assets/css/style.css @@ -1,6 +1,7 @@ /* HERO */ .hero { align-items: center; + box-shadow: 0 1px 2.25px var(--green); color: var(--foreground); display: flex; flex-direction: column; @@ -17,6 +18,10 @@ text-align: center; } +.hero > p { + font-size: var(--p); +} + .cta { background-color: var(--green); border: 1px solid var(--green); @@ -27,7 +32,7 @@ padding: 0.75rem 1.45rem; text-align: center; transition: all 0.25s; - width: 80%; + width: 15rem; } .cta:hover { @@ -35,4 +40,44 @@ color: var(--green); } -/* CONTACT */
\ No newline at end of file +/* CONTACT */ +.contact { + align-items: center; + box-shadow: 0 1px 2.25px var(--green); + display: flex; + flex-direction: column; + min-height: 90vh; + text-align: center; + justify-content: center; +} + +.contact__title { + font-size: var(--h3); + margin-bottom: 1.45rem; +} + +.contact__form { + display: grid; + grid-template-areas: "name" "email" "submit"; + grid-template-columns: 1fr; + grid-template-rows: repeat(3, auto); + width: 100%; +} + +.submit { + background-color: var(--green); + border: 1px solid var(--green); + border-radius: 15px; + color: var(--foreground); + font-size: var(--p); + margin-top: 3.45rem; + padding: 0.75rem 1.45rem; + transition: all 0.25s; + width: 15rem; +} + +.submit:hover, +.submit:active { + background-color: var(--background); + color: var(--green); +}
\ No newline at end of file |